Produktbeschreibung
Like New Virtual Field Trips, this book provides hours of opportunities for educators and students to travel throughout the world and back and forth in time to study natural phenomena and participate in cultural and scientific activities with practicing professionals and other classrooms worldwide.
The amazing growth and popularity of the Internet means more opportunities to learn! Responding to the tremendous interest in their previous volume (Virtual Field Trips, Libraries Unlimited, 1997) and to specific requests from users, Cooper and Cooper bring you a host of new and exciting sites for educational field trips into cyberspace. The new trips and topics reflect current curricular requirements and goals such as business, women's history, conflict resolution, and multiculturalism. Trips for physically and emotionally challenged students and for those who wish to get to know them better have been added and there are more sites for physical education, health and safety, rural, and architectural trips. Like the first volume, this book is organized by subject. Autorenporträt
GAIL COOPER, a writer and licensed clinical social worker, is a contributing editor of Family Therapy Networker. GARRY COOPER, a licensed clinical social worker and writer from Oak Park, Illinois, is a regular columnist for several newsletters.
